Applied Biochemist (27579)

Cambridge
to c£38,000 DoE

Hands-on lab development of new technologies involving microfluidic techniques

This life science tech start up are looking for an Applied Biochemist to join their growing team. The role is multidisciplinary and really would utilise skills and knowledge from a range of scientific areas. The position would be based in their labs and will involve designing and prototyping experimental systems, capturing data from biophysical assays, developing SOPs to ensure experimental reproducibility, and supporting IP generation.

Requirements:

  • MRes or MPhil in Biochemistry, Chemistry or Biophysics, with demonstrable project experience incorporating microfluidics. PhD candidates would be considered.
  • Strong project experience working in a scientific lab ideally within a multidisciplinary team.
  • Experience handling proteins or nucleic acids.
  • Any experience with Arduino used for test rigs, or Python scripting for automation would be desirable.

Only applicants with unrestricted rights to work in the UK will be considered, no company sponsorship is available. Applicants should be immediately available or have a short notice period.

This is an exciting opportunity to join a start up, work on innovative technology and be part of an interesting applied scientific project.
